A leading healthcare provider in the UK is seeking a compassionate Bank Care Assistant in Canterbury to support older residents with daily living activities. The role includes providing companionship, helping with food and drink, and ensuring each resident receives individual attention.

Ideal candidates will have caring experience and strong communication skills. In return, you will receive comprehensive training and development opportunities in a flexible working environment. Join us in delivering exceptional care to those in need.

How to prepare for a job interview at Barchester Healthcare

Show Your Compassion

In this role, compassion is key. Be ready to share specific examples from your past experiences where you demonstrated empathy and care for others. This will show the interviewer that you truly understand the importance of the role.

Communicate Clearly

Strong communication skills are essential for a Care Assistant.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. You might even want to prepare answers to common interview questions about how you would handle certain situations with residents.

Research the Company

Familiarise yourself with the healthcare provider's values and mission. Understanding their approach to care will help you align your answers with what they’re looking for, making you a more appealing candidate.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ions to ask at the end of the interview. This shows your genuine interest in the role and the company. You could ask about the training opportunities or how they support their staff in providing exceptional care.
